You have been asked by the president of Ellis Construction Company, headquarter in Toledo, to evaluate the proposed acquisition of a new earth-mover. The mover's basic price is 50,000, and it will cost another 10,000 to modify it for special use by Ellis Construction. It will be sold after 3 years for 20,000, and it will require an increase in net operating working capital (spare parts inventory) of 2,000. the earth-mover purchase will have no effect on revenues, but it is expected to save Ellis 20,000 per year in before-tax operating costs, mainly labor. Ellis's tax rate is 40 percent.

Question A. What is the company's net investment if it acquires the Earth-mover?

Question B. What are the operating cash flows in Years 1, 2, and 3? (note: same cash flow for 3 years)

Question C. What is the terminal year cash flow?
